The Statue of Poseidon was a gigantic marble statue of the Greek god Poseidon on the Island of Triton, counted as part of Samos.
During the Peloponnesian War, the Spartan misthios Kassandra visited the statue at the request of the Athenian sculptor Phidias to find a symbol.[1] At the same time, she recovered a trident from chest allegedly belonging to the god of the sea.[2]
Sometime thereafter, Kassandra returned to the island where she met a projection of the Isu Aletheia. Kassandra was appointed by the her as the Keeper of the Staff of Hermes Trismegistus and was tasked to look for Theras, a friend of the late Phidias.[3]
